A staff member has been critically injured after an assault at Whanganui Community Corrections in the central city.
In a statement, Corrections described how staff had “intervened and subdued the offender” during the assault at the Wilson St service centre about 10am on Wednesday.
Department of Corrections communities, partnerships and pathways director Glenn Morrison said a staff member was taken to hospital.
“While we are limited in the information we can provide at this stage, we understand their condition is not life-threatening.
“I would like to acknowledge our Corrections staff who intervened and subdued the offender,” he said.
